Account recovery — Fixturewright gotcha. If a customer's account got mangled by stale seed data, it's almost always the Fixturewright test-data factory writing to the wrong tenant. Don't hand-edit rows; run the recovery script from the Dunmere toolbox and let it rebuild the profile. The script asks you to unlock the recovery keyring first — use the passphrase shown below.

vault phrase of kafog-kahif = holdor-rusir-praox

Fabrikit, our test-data factory library, ships as a versioned internal package and is deployed alongside the Marrowtide staging stack. Reviewers should note that factories are seeded deterministically per environment, so snapshot diffs in CI are stable across runs. Deployment is a two-step process: publish the package from the release branch, then bump the pin in the staging manifest. No database migrations are involved, but factories must match the current schema version. The deployment expects the following configuration values.

deployment values, hahaf-fahop:
zorwyn:
  log_level: debug
  metrics_host: metrics.zorwyn.tolvaqlabs.internal
  pool_size: 8

Ticket: Staging env misconfigured for Siftgate bloom filter

The bloom layer in front of the Pellet KV store is rejecting all lookups in staging because the env file was copied from the dev template without credentials. False-positive tuning values are fine; only the auth line is missing. To unblock the weekly demo, the Pellet admission secret must be set on the following line.

env line for yaguf-fajop: LEDGER_TOKEN13=fb08984397349

Changelog — SweepStone v1.9.0 (orphaned-resource sweeper). Rotated the artifact signing key as part of the annual rotation policy. All sweeper builds from this version onward are signed with the new key; v1.8.x artifacts verify against the retired key, which remains trusted until end of quarter. Maintainers updating the verification config should replace the pinned entry with the current key, recorded below.

deploy key for hahig-hawef: bky19_9W9dmiNXYN4YvPQNRSS